共 1 篇文章

标签:Java客房管理系统数据库完美解决方案 (客房管理系统数据库 java)

Java客房管理系统数据库完美解决方案 (客房管理系统数据库 java)

随着住宿服务业的发展,客房管理系统已成为了重要的工具。它可以帮助酒店实现客房管理的自动化,提高工作效率,减少人力成本。而Java是一种广泛应用于企业级应用的编程语言,它在开发客房管理系统中也是非常常用的一种语言。然而,开发客房管理系统时遇到的更大问题之一就是如何设计一个高效、可靠的数据库。本文将介绍一种完美的Java客房管理系统数据库解决方案,旨在帮助开发人员更好地构建数据库,提高系统的性能和可靠性。 采用MySQL数据库 MySQL是一个开源的关系型数据库管理系统,被广泛应用于Web应用程序的开发中。MySQL具有高性能、高可靠性、易于使用、良好的扩展性和强大的安全性等优点。因此,采用MySQL数据库可以满足客房管理系统的需求,使系统更加稳定可靠,确保客房管理系统的高效运行。 数据库结构设计 在设计数据库结构时,需要充分考虑业务逻辑、数据特征、可扩展性等各方面因素。客房管理系统的数据库包含多个表,包括客房信息、客户信息、订单信息等。具体表的设计如下: 客房信息表 客房信息表用于存储酒店所有客房的相关信息,包括客房号、价格、类型、状态等。此表应该至少包括以下字段: 客房号:客房的唯一标识符。 类型:客房的类型,如单人间、双人间、标准间、豪华套房等。 价格:客房的基础价格。 状态:客房的状态,如已入住、未入住、清洁中等。 客户信息表 客户信息表用于存储客户的基本信息,包括姓名、性别、、身份证号等。此表应该至少包括以下字段: 客户ID:客户的唯一标识符。 姓名:客户的姓名。 性别:客户的性别。 :客户的联系。 身份证号:客户的身份证号。 订单信息表 订单信息表用于存储订单相关信息,包括订单号、入住时间、离店时间、客房号、房价等。此表应该至少包括以下字段: 订单号:订单的唯一标识符。 客房号:订单对应的客房。 客户ID:订单对应的客户。 入住时间:客户入住的时间。 离店时间:客户退房的时间。 房价:订单实际支付的金额。 数据库性能优化 在数据库的运行中,常常需要经常查询、更新、删除等操作,因此需要对数据库进行性能优化,以使其运行更加快速、高效。以下是一些可能的性能优化方法: 建立索引:建立索引可以使数据库的查找和排序速度更快。可以尝试为表中最常用的字段建立索引,例如客房号、订单号等。 避免全表扫描:尽量使用具有条件的查询语句,避免全表查询。 适时清理无用数据:定期清理不再使用的数据,释放不必要的空间。 Java客房管理系统数据库的构建需要严格按照业务逻辑进行设计,采用关系型数据库MySQL会更好的实现系统的可靠性和稳定性。同时,在数据库的性能优化方面,可以使用索引和定期清理数据以提高系统的性能。只有对数据库的设计和优化做到位,才能使酒店的客房管理系统更加可靠、快速、高效地运行。 相关问题拓展阅读: 求助,用JAVA编写酒店管理系统的界面,哪里有什么教程吗? JAVA简单酒店管理系统源代码 求助,用JAVA编写酒店管理系统的界面,哪里有什么教程吗? 只用编写界面么?看看jsp教程就行啦~~ 酒店管理系统,个人觉得可以参考网派森上商城等等视频,马士兵有这方面的视频。 配好网站开发的环境,jsp等需败好要学习,数据库的话考察羡铅虑mysql,足够满足课程设计数据需求。 JAVA简单酒店管理系统源代码 100元给你定做一个 参考立友信酒店管理系统. 我认为酒店管理系统更好的了. $程$如果您的要求与此类似,也可以与我们联系 $序$有偿处理此类问题, $代$功能可定制,适应不同需求 $做$可 Baidu Hi / 发私信 / 发追问 / 发求助 / 或+Q 关于客房管理系统数据库 java的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。

技术分享